The Portland PostgreSQL Users Group (PDXPUG) is planning a day of
PostgreSQL presentations for Monday Sept 10th, 2018, at Portland State
University. [1]
If you are interested in presenting, there is a submission form online.
[2] We are hoping to provide a range of topics from what's new in
Postgres and case studies about how Postgres is being used.
The event will be free to attend, but please RSVP [3] as space may be
limited.
